When is it wrong and/or inappropriate to use a slash mark?
Do not use a slash (also called a virgule, solidus, or shill)
when a phrase would be clearer
Each child handed the ball to her mother or guardian.
not
Each child handed the ball to her mother/guardian.
for simple comparisons
Use a hyphen or short dash (en dash) instead.
test–retest reliability
not
test/retest reliability
more than once to express compound units. Use centered dots and parentheses as needed to prevent ambiguity.
nmol • hr-1 • mg -1
not
nmol/hr/mg
(adapted from the fifth edition of APA's Publication Manual, © 2001)
